
A Field Atlas of the Seashore by Julian Cremona
This guide covers the six main seashore habitats of Northern Europe using photographs, line drawings and text. As well as aiding identification of over 200 characteristic plants and animals, it examines the ecology of each species including the problems of life and habitat and how to resolve them.
John Archer-Thomson and Julian Cremona have spent their working lives in environmental education and conservation. They are respective former Assistant Head and Head of the Field Studies Council's Dale Fort Field Centre in Pembrokeshire. John is now a freelance coastal ecologist, photographer, writer and tutor, while Julian has authored a number of books on exploration, nature and photography.
